Output 94b4023596ec7de30f9cbb444ee5ea67427d9f1f2538229f037a654bc61f9a5d:42

value
50740721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88760a830a4b8f591169a76f4c5a1fccccb241dc OP_EQUAL
address
MLLhY9zhGsUs25HS8WqRrBVvG9nf4rFPv9
transaction
94b4023596ec7de30f9cbb444ee5ea67427d9f1f2538229f037a654bc61f9a5d
spent
true